What renovations and updates must an Amorino franchisee complete as a condition of renewal?
Amorino Franchise · 2025 FDDAnswer from 2025 FDD Document
The following provisions will govern any renewal term:
- (1) You must make any improvements that Amorino deems necessary to bring the Store into conformity with Amorino's then-current standards for its franchisees.
No later than 180 days prior to expiration of the current term, Amorino will give you a list of all necessary renovations, upgrades, and new or replacement furniture, fixtures, and equipment that must be purchased or installed, however failure to timely provide such list shall not be a waiver of Amorino's right to require that such improvements or upgrades be made.
As a condition of your renewal, you must perform such work and replace such furniture, fixtures and equipment prior to expiration of the then-current term.
Source: Item 22 — CONTRACTS (FDD pages 80–81)
What This Means (2025 FDD)
According to Amorino's 2025 Franchise Disclosure Document, a franchisee must make any improvements that Amorino deems necessary to bring the store into conformity with Amorino's then-current standards for its franchisees as a condition of renewal. Amorino will provide a list of all necessary renovations, upgrades, and new or replacement furniture, fixtures, and equipment that must be purchased or installed no later than 180 days prior to the expiration of the current term. However, if Amorino fails to provide the list on time, it does not waive its right to require the improvements or upgrades.
To maintain the franchise, the franchisee must complete the required work and replace the necessary furniture, fixtures, and equipment before the current term expires. This ensures that all Amorino locations maintain a consistent brand image and meet the company's standards.
Prospective franchisees should be aware of these potential renovation costs when considering an Amorino franchise. They should inquire about the typical scope and cost of these required updates to factor them into their long-term financial planning.
